Job Description
Position: Director of Billing & Collections
Location: Fully Remote, but candidate must reside in CA, NJ, NY, DC, TX, CO, IL, MA
Pay: $175,000 to $275,000/yr (Depending on experience)
Experience: 10+ years of experience to oversee and optimize firm financial processes.
Education: Bachelor’s degree in finance, accounting, business administration, or related field; advanced degree or professional certification (e.g., CPA, MBA) preferred.
Type: Full-time; Direct Hire
Schedule: Monday – Friday, 9am to 5:30pm
Kent Daniels & Associates is seeking a Director of Billing & Collections to join our dynamic law firm client!
Job Description:
- Developing and implementing strategic plans to optimize the billing and collections process, ensuring compliance with firm policies and industry regulations.
- Overseeing the billing cycle, including invoice generation, distribution, and tracking, to ensure accuracy and timeliness.
- Managing collections including monitoring outstanding invoices, communicating with attorneys, and clients, regarding payment status, and resolving billing disputes.
- Analyzing billing and collections data to identify trends, areas for improvement, and opportunities to enhance revenue generation.
- Collaborating with attorneys, partners, and other stakeholders to address billing/collections issues, providing guidance on client billing arrangements, and streamlining processes.
- Leading and mentoring a dispersed hybrid/remote billing and collections team, providing guidance, training, and performance feedback to ensure high-quality service delivery.
- Developing and maintaining relationships with attorneys, addressing billing inquiries in a professional and timely manner.
- Staying informed about industry best practices, trends, and technologies related to billing and collections, and implementing innovative solutions to improve efficiency and effectiveness.
Position Requirements:
- Proven experience in billing and collections management, preferably within a law firm or professional services environment, with a strong understanding of legal billing practices and regulations.
- Prior experience working with leading law firm time and billing applications such as Aderant Expert, Elite Enterprise, or Elite 3E is required.
- Prior experience and working knowledge of ARCS (strongly preferred).
- Highly proficient with Microsoft Office (Outlook, Excel, PowerPoint, Word).
- Familiar with team collaboration platforms MS Teams and SmartSheet.
- Excellent analytical skills and attention to detail, with the ability to analyze complex financial data and identify opportunities for process improvement.
- Strong leadership and communication skills, with the ability to effectively lead a team, collaborate with cross-functional stakeholders, and communicate with clients.
-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ment, managing multiple priorities and deadlines with a focus on delivering exceptional results.
- Strong ethical standards and commitment to maintaining confidentiality and integrity in all financial matters.
- Strong leadership skills, a deep understanding of financial systems and related technology, and the ability to collaborate effectively with internal teams and external clients.
